随着城市发展的脚步不断加快,上海这座国际化大都市也面临着老旧小区改造的重要课题。“老破小”不仅影响着居民的生活品质,也制约着城市功能的提升。在这一背景下,旧城小区的系统性改造迫在眉睫,而其中,作为城市“血脉”与“神经”的管道系统升级,更是重中之重。公元管道,作为国内塑料管道行业的领军企业,正以其丰富的产品线和全场景的应用能力,深度参与上海旧城小区改造,为“老破小”的华丽转身贡献力量。

旧小区的管道问题往往错综复杂,涉及给水、排水、燃气、供暖、弱电等多个方面。老化的铸铁管、镀锌管易生锈、结垢,导致水质下降、水压不足;排水管道不畅则易引发堵塞、返味,甚至污水渗漏;燃气管道的安全隐患更是关乎生命财产安全。公元管道深刻理解这些痛点,针对不同应用场景提供了定制化的解决方案。

在居民日常生活用水方面,公元给水管材凭借其优异的耐腐蚀性、光滑内壁不结垢、水流阻力小等特性,确保了供水的安全与通畅,让居民用上“放心水”。排水系统则采用了公元高抗冲排水管材及管件,具有重量轻、强度高、安装便捷、排水量大且噪音低的优势,有效解决了老旧小区排水不畅的难题,改善了居住环境。

对于燃气输送这一关键领域,公元燃气管以其严格的质量控制和卓越的安全性能,成为旧改项目中燃气管道更新的可靠选择,为居民的安全用气保驾护航。同时,在小区的弱电管网改造中,公元的电工套管等产品,为通信、网络、监控等智能化系统的升级提供了坚实的“通道”支持,助力老旧小区迈向智慧化管理。

公元管道不仅提供高品质的产品,更注重整体解决方案的优化。其全场景的产品布局,意味着从地下到地上,从供水到排污,从能源输送到信息传递,都能找到对应的公元产品。这种“一站式”的产品供应能力,大大提高了施工效率,缩短了改造周期,最大限度地减少了对居民日常生活的影响。
